Introducing Feedback Hub and Customer Thermometer
Feedback Hub, Customer Thermometer, Canny, Userback, etc., belong to a category of solutions that help Customer Feedback Management. Different products excel in different areas, so the best platform for your business will depend on your specific needs and requirements.
Feedback Hub covers Collecting Feedback, Collaboration with User Generated Content, Helpdesk Management with User Generated Content, Campaign Management with Social Media, etc.
Customer Thermometer focuses on Collecting Feedback, Helpdesk Management, Engaging Conversational Surveys, Communication Management with E-Mail, etc.
